At 27, he went on a
Birthright trip to Israel.
In 2014, he took a trip to
Peru and hiked the Andes
Mountains to Machu
Picchu.
“I took notes the entire
time, and when I came
home, I wrote — and
finished — my first true
adventure story, all through
the lens of a former standup
comedian,” said Reisig
who titled it the Inca Trail
to Machu Picchu: Sixteen
Strangers and the Quest for
the Holy Facebook Photo.
Famed actor Robert
Redford wrote to Reisig:
“Best wishes as you continue
on your adventures.”
Those adventures — the
basis for the next three books
— include entering the
world’s longest kayak race,
dog sledding in Michigan’s
U.P., bull riding, driving in
a demolition derby, alligator
wrestling, a turn as a rodeo
clown and boxing on the
Golden Gloves circuit.
“I’ve been called the
‘Jewish Jack London,’ but I
prefer JPR,” Joel Paul Reisig
laughed.
